Looking really cool man. The black and white looks is really nice. However I think you need to push the body into even darker tons in areas, its all kind of a middle grey right now, and the boots, and shirt shadow could really use some darker near black shades. nice looking rig setup.

The rig , god its got a problem im trying to avaoid fixing ... i think at some point ive messed it up ... i made it a couple of months ago , and try to stick it , (or parts of it) on my models .. at the moment , when i rotate the rig locator , the spine spline ik handles dont more , or the head box and shoulders boxes , i did have some expressions in there too which helped on animating the walking etc ... which reminds my ive gota make some channels for face rigging , and stuff ... lots to do ... i dont enjoy the rigging side of things as much as modeling ....
